ACP-267: Primary Network validator uptime requirement increases from 80% to 90%.Read the proposal
Certora

Certora

Certora provides high-quality formal verification and security audits for smart contracts with specialized expertise in mathematical verification.

Back

Overview

Certora is a security firm specializing in formal verification and security audits for smart contracts. Using their proprietary Certora Prover, they mathematically verify security properties of smart contracts, providing assurance beyond traditional auditing. Their team of formal verification experts is highly recommended by security teams in the Avalanche ecosystem.

Features

  • Formal Verification: Mathematical verification of smart contract properties using the Certora Prover.
  • Smart Contract Audits: Security reviews combining formal methods with traditional auditing.
  • Custom Specification Development: Creation of formal specifications for critical security properties.
  • Automated Analysis: Advanced automated tools for detecting vulnerabilities.
  • Security Research: Ongoing research into formal verification techniques for blockchain security.
  • Developer Education: Resources for implementing formally verifiable smart contracts.

Getting Started

  1. Initial Contact: Reach out to Certora at [email protected] or [email protected] to discuss your project.
  2. Scoping Process: Define the audit scope, formal verification requirements, and timeline.
  3. Audit and Verification Process:
    • Formal specification development
    • Mathematical verification using the Certora Prover
    • Traditional security audit methodologies
    • Vulnerability assessment
  4. Results Delivery: Detailed report of findings, verification results, and remediation recommendations.
  5. Post-Audit Support: Assistance with implementing fixes and re-verification as needed.

Documentation

For more details, visit the Certora Documentation.

Use Cases

  • High-Value DeFi Protocols: Mathematical verification of financial properties.
  • Complex Smart Contract Systems: Formal verification of intricate contract interactions.
  • Novel Financial Mechanisms: Validation of innovative DeFi mechanisms and algorithms.
  • Protocol Implementations: Verification of protocol specification compliance.
  • Security-Critical Applications: Projects where security failures would have significant consequences.

Is this guide helpful?

Developer:

Certora

Categories:

Security Audits

Available For:

C-Chain
All Avalanche L1s

Website:

https://www.certora.com/

Documentation:

https://docs.certora.com/en/latest/